Music Broadcast Limited (NSE:RADIOCITY)
India flag India · Delayed Price · Currency is INR
8.14
+0.02 (0.25%)
Oct 17, 2025, 3:30 PM IST

Music Broadcast Ratios and Metrics

Millions INR. Fiscal year is Apr - Mar.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 20212016 - 2020
Period Ending
Oct '25 Mar '25 Mar '24 Mar '23 Mar '22 Mar '21 2016 - 2020
2,8143,1255,5833,7338,9198,141
Upgrade
Market Cap Growth
-48.71%-44.02%49.54%-58.14%9.55%58.05%
Upgrade
Enterprise Value
2,5423,4395,8243,3158,0176,382
Upgrade
Last Close Price
8.149.0416.1510.8025.8023.55
Upgrade
PE Ratio
--81.57108.53--
Upgrade
PS Ratio
1.261.332.441.885.306.38
Upgrade
PB Ratio
0.570.631.050.711.481.34
Upgrade
P/TBV Ratio
0.690.771.401.002.071.96
Upgrade
P/FCF Ratio
-70.4830.6217.6345.67155.71
Upgrade
P/OCF Ratio
-18.8220.4812.1939.23149.35
Upgrade
EV/Sales Ratio
1.131.472.551.674.765.00
Upgrade
EV/EBITDA Ratio
19.97-88.61---
Upgrade
EV/FCF Ratio
-77.5631.9415.6641.05122.07
Upgrade
Debt / Equity Ratio
0.250.250.200.190.030.04
Upgrade
Debt / EBITDA Ratio
9.90-8.5139.18--
Upgrade
Debt / FCF Ratio
-28.425.844.641.004.48
Upgrade
Asset Turnover
-0.350.340.300.260.19
Upgrade
Quick Ratio
-1.763.743.673.469.96
Upgrade
Current Ratio
-1.854.134.084.3410.78
Upgrade
Return on Equity (ROE)
--6.57%1.30%0.61%-0.94%-3.90%
Upgrade
Return on Assets (ROA)
--1.69%-0.03%-0.93%-2.07%-4.13%
Upgrade
Return on Capital (ROIC)
-2.86%-1.80%-0.03%-0.98%-2.16%-4.32%
Upgrade
Earnings Yield
-13.71%-10.83%1.23%0.92%-0.64%-2.97%
Upgrade
FCF Yield
-1.42%3.27%5.67%2.19%0.64%
Upgrade
Payout Ratio
--0.13%---
Upgrade
Buyback Yield / Dilution
4.45%-----
Upgrade
Updated Jun 30,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.